Great Media Technologies Pvt Ltd (Grmtech) is a Kolkata-based IT and ITeS company founded in May 2003.

Grmtech develops and maintains its projects in the USA with its associate companies. These projects are from the finance and legal industry in the USA. Grmtech has 2 offices in Kolkata, over 15 medical clinics, and 2 legal offices in California.

We work with Stanford Hospital mental health doctors and psychologists across the USA.

Grmtech does all back office work for Savantcare doctors, like managing patients' appointments, providing doctors assistance on the phone, chat, and email. We also work for OVLG to provide the best legal services in the US. We have a qualified FC team and a CRA team who offer free budget counseling sessions to clients and negotiate with their creditors for settlement.

This is configured using tools -> options -> main 2. Reducing the memory used by firefox. Follow the steps listed on: http://blog.codefront.net/2008/09/10/optimize-firefoxs-memory-usage-by-tweaking-session-preferences/ browser.sessionhistory.max_entries = 1 browser.sessionhistory.max_total_viewers = 1 browser.sessionstore.max_tabs_undo = 1 browser.sessionstore.interval = 1000000 milliseconds. = 1000 seconds. network.http.max-connections = 48 network.http.max-connections-per-server = 24 network.http.max-persistent-connections-per-proxy = 12 network.http.max-persistent-connections-per-server = 6 network.http.pipelining = "true" network.http.pipelining.maxrequests = 32 browser.cache.disk.capacity = 8192 network.http.pipelining.ssl = "true" network.http.proxy.pipelining = "true" nglayout.initialpaint.delay = 0 (If it does not exit, this entry has to be created by rightclicking anywhere and selecting new>Integer) network.dns.disableIPv6 = "true" image.animation_mode = "once" network.prefetch-next = "false" 3. Disable "Google update" firefox plugin (Tools>Add-ons>Plugins>Google Update>Disable). 4. Disable java from tools>option>content. Icons on the Desktop 1.
